Cannabis Deliveries Approved Throughout California

[dropcap class=”kp-dropcap”]C[/dropcap]annabis deliveries will be available throughout the state of California, regardless of local laws. The California Bureau of Cannabis Control announced that cannabis home deliveries will be allowed statewide, even in communities that have previously banned commercial cannabis sales.

“The way it would work is similar to pizza delivery,” California Cannabis Industry Association (CCIA) Communications and Outreach Director Josh Drayton said. “If a pizza delivery company is in one city, it can deliver into another. The way that this would read for cannabis is that if a delivery service is located in a regulated area, and they are licensed, they are still able to deliver into banned cities and counties.”

The move was well received by cannabis companies that note large stretches of the state do not allow recreational sales, which prevents residents from enjoying their legal right to consume cannabis. The Bureau of Cannabis Control said the state overwhelmingly supports delivery statewide, however, local governments aren’t too thrilled as the new ruling diminishes their authority. Police chiefs and other critics opposed the regulation, predicting the new ruling would create an unruly market of hidden cannabis transactions that aren’t subject to the testing regulations California has passed and that aren’t subject to the various taxes from legal sales.

Cannabis business advocates welcome the opportunity to expand into parts of California and believe the new ruling on deliveries will help deter black-market cannabis sales. Critics of the ruling believe the delivery rule is overreaching into an area that should be subject to local control. The League of California Cities has referred to the new ruling as “extremely troubling.”

All delivery vehicles are required by the state to be tracked by a GPS locator and the amount carried by the driver during the delivery should be a “reasonable amount” and locked inside a safe inside the vehicle.
